BILLING TO SAG

By Leigh Perry

Blue Cross and Blue Shield of California no longer handles the claims for The Screen Actors Guild. These claims are now handled directly through SAG. The problem with SAG is that they do not feel that it is medically necessary, in most circumstances, for an anesthesiologist to provide the anesthesia for patients receiving EGD's and colonoscopies in the office. If you are an anesthesiologist that provides for this service and your location has patients that belong to SAG, it is very important to get a letter of medical necessity from the GI so that you can forward it with your bill to SAG. The letter must state the reasons why your services were required. Such situations as extreme anxiety, severe rectal bleeding, banding and removal of hemorrhoids, dementia or life threatening physical conditions could be reasons for medical necessity.

Even with this letter of medical necessity, there is no guarantee SAG will pay but it does give you a better chance. Of course, all of this depends on the relationship you have with the GI's office. If it is a congenial one, you can be more hopeful of getting a proper letter of medical necessity. If you do not have a good relationship then, quite frankly, good luck! You can try to argue necessity on your own with SAG, but they may not accept it. Even if you solicit the aid of the patient, it is rare that SAG will find in your favor. According to them, their medical review board had decided that there is no need for an anesthesiologist to give the sedation and even if you argue that you are providing Monitored Anesthesia Care, they will reply that this is also something that the does not require an anesthesiologist.
